How much does a solar battery cost?

A home solar battery costs roughly £3,000–£6,000 installed depending on capacity (5–10 kWh). It stores daytime solar for evening use and can add backup power.

In more detail

Batteries improve how much of your own solar you use (self-consumption), which is where most savings come from once export rates are low. Payback is typically 8–12 years.
